// QUERY_PLANNER_FALLBACK_THRESHOLD
//
// Context for new folks: the Marrowstone planner regressed in the
// autumn release, choosing nested-loop joins for wide fact tables
// and blowing past our latency budget on the Tidegate cluster.
// This constant forces the fallback plan whenever estimated rows
// exceed the threshold. Do not raise it without rerunning the
// regression suite owned by the storage team; the bad plans only
// appear under skewed statistics. The regression was first seen
// in the build identified by the token below.

pipeline stamp: htk9_6ce9d33c5

## Formula sandbox tuning

User-supplied formulas in Gridmoor execute inside a restricted interpreter with hard ceilings on time, memory, and call depth. Reviewers should confirm any change to these ceilings is justified in the PR description, since raising them widens the abuse surface. Defaults were chosen from production traces. The current limits are as follows.

limits module of tafog-fawip:
WEIGHTS = {
    "julix": 57,
    "lamys": 992,
    "kasvan": 209,
    "quenok": 750,
    "alddor": 259,
    "oliath": 1009,
    "wenix": 815,
}

**CI note: timezone weirdness in report exports**

Heads up, support folks — if a customer says their Ledgerpine export shows times shifted by a few hours, it's probably the CI image. The export workers got rebuilt last week and the base image defaults to UTC, while older workers used the account's locale. Fix is rolling out; meanwhile tell customers the data itself is fine, just the display offset. Affected exports carry the build token shown below.

build token for bajof-tahop: htk4_a981

Changed defaults in Splitfork, our assignment service. Bucketing now uses sticky hashing per account instead of per session, and the holdout slice grew from 2% to 5%. Callers relying on session-level reassignment must opt in explicitly. Review the diff against the new baseline; the updated default configuration is listed below.

config for tagep-kajof:
[casir]
port = 6379
region = south-1
host = casir.paliqdyn.example
team = tamax
timeout_ms = 250
retries = 2